INFORMATION

Explanation of reports.

Minor Condition: Temp Rise of 1-20 F. Repair during regular maintenance, little chance of
physical damage.

Alert Condition: Temp Rise of 21-40 F. Repair within 30 days. Watch amperage load and
inspect for physical damage.

SERIOUS CONDITION: Temp Rise of 41-60F. Repair/Replace ASAP! Inspect surrounding


components for physical damage.

CRITICAL: Temp Rise > 61F. IMMEDIATE REPAIR/REPLACEMENT.


DANGEROUS CONDITION EXISTS!

The Ambient temperature is shown to indicate the surrounding temperature.

The Reference temperature is shown to provide a reference to a similar object under the same
conditions as the object showing the high temperature.

The High temperature is the highest temperature registered either inside an area box, as seen
in IR images, or in the entire image.

The Temperature rise is shown to indicate the difference in temperature between the
Reference temperature and the High temperature.
